Ï㽶ÊÓƵ

Minerva Class Scheduling Visit for course dates & times.

Dernières mises à jour en lien avec la COVID-19 disponibles ici.
Latest information about COVID-19 available here.

COMP 627 Theoretical Programming Languages (4 credits)

important

Note: This is the 2021–2022 eCalendar. Update the year in your browser's URL bar for the most recent version of this page, or .

Offered by: Computer Science (Faculty of Science)

Administered by: Graduate Studies

Overview

Computer Science (Sci) : Programming language semantics. Lambda calculus, the Church Rosser theorem, typed lambda calculus, the strong normalization theorem, polymorphism, type inference, elements of domain theory, models of the lambda calculus, relating operational and denotational semantics, full abstraction. Reasoning about programs. Soundness and relative completeness of program logics.

Terms: This course is not scheduled for the 2021-2022 academic year.

Instructors: There are no professors associated with this course for the 2021-2022 academic year.

Back to top